/**
* This script is used to randomly sample from input_vocabulary.txt and
* stemmed_result.txt text files available for a given locale at
* http://snowball.tartarus.org/algorithms/ and output only a 1000 words and
* stems so that unit test for stems can be of a manageable size
*/
$num_samples = 1000;
$locale = 'greek_stemmer';
$words = file("$locale/input_vocabulary.txt");
$stems = file("$locale/stemmed_result.txt");
$num_words = count($words);
$sample_words = [];
$sample_stems = [];
$indices = [];
for ($i = 0; $i < $num_samples; $i++) {
do {
$rand = rand(0, $num_words - 1);
} while (isset($indices[$rand]));
$indices[$rand] = true;
}
$indices = array_keys($indices);
sort($indices);
for ($i = 0; $i < $num_samples; $i++) {
$index = $indices[$i];
$sample_words[] = trim($words[$index]);
$sample_stems[] = trim($stems[$index]);
}
file_put_contents("input_vocabulary.txt", implode("\n", $sample_words));
file_put_contents("stemmed_result.txt", implode("\n", $sample_stems));
